at-the-end-of-the-day
idiom
/æt ði ɛnd ʌv ðə deɪ/
Definition
An idiomatic expression used to summarize or conclude a discussion by emphasizing what ultimately matters.
Examples
- At the end of the day, we all want to be happy.
- We can debate this issue all we want, but at the end of the day, it’s the results that count.
Meaning
This phrase is often used to highlight the most important factor in a situation or decision, regardless of other details.
Synonyms
- Ultimately
- In the final analysis
- When all is said and done
